casper_executor_wasm_common/
env_info.rs

1use safe_transmute::TriviallyTransmutable;
2
3#[derive(Clone, Copy)]
4#[repr(C)]
5pub struct EnvInfo {
6    pub block_time: u64,
7    pub transferred_value: u64,
8    pub caller_addr: [u8; 32],
9    pub caller_kind: u32,
10    pub callee_addr: [u8; 32],
11    pub callee_kind: u32,
12}
13
14unsafe impl TriviallyTransmutable for EnvInfo {}